一、基础环境搭建
搭建私服前需准备以下核心要素:选择4核CPU/8GB内存以上的服务器硬件,推荐使用Windows Server或CentOS系统。网络环境要求固定IP地址并开放7000-7500端口组,建议通过云服务器提供商实现公网接入。
- 下载对应游戏服务端(如1.76传奇端或魔兽单机版)并解压至根目录
- 安装DBC2000数据库并配置ODBC数据源
- 部署MySQL 5.0+环境并创建专用数据库
二、配置优化方案
通过服务端参数调整提升运行效率:
- 设置经验倍率(建议5-10倍)与爆率参数
- 限制最大在线人数防止服务器过载
- 启用内存缓存机制加速数据库查询
参数项 | 默认值 | 推荐值 |
---|---|---|
怪物刷新间隔 | 60秒 | 30秒 |
地图加载线程 | 4线程 | 8线程 |
三、安全部署策略
保障私服稳定运行的关键措施:
- 配置iptables防火墙规则,仅开放必要端口
- 设置每日凌晨自动备份玩家数据与物品库
- 创建独立管理员账户并启用操作日志审计
建议使用Nginx反向代理隐藏真实IP,并部署SSL证书加密通信。
四、一键生成工具实战
基于Docker实现快速部署:
docker run -d \
-p 8081:8081 \
-v /opt/nexus-data:/nexus-data \
--name my_private_server \
sonatype/nexus3
该方案可自动完成环境配置、服务部署和资源加载,支持通过Web界面修改游戏参数。
私服搭建需兼顾技术实现与法律合规,建议在单机测试通过后再进行公网部署。定期更新服务端补丁、监控服务器负载峰值、建立玩家社区反馈机制,可有效延长私服生命周期。